The St George Local Business Awards are back, and founder Steve Loe has called on the community to nominate their favourite businesses.
Mr Loe, managing director of Precedent Productions, founded the awards more than three decades ago.
He said it was an opportunity for members of the community to encourage and show appreciation for outstanding providers of goods and services.
‘‘Business owners, managers and staff work hard and often go above and beyond to help their clients and customers,’’ Mr Loe said.
‘‘As members of the community, we reap the benefits of their efforts, which can make our own lives happier and easier in many ways.
‘‘Sometimes it’s as simple as a friendly smile and sympathetic ear from the staff in a shop that lifts your spirits when you’re having a bad day.
‘‘Or it may be a supplier who works tirelessly to ensure an urgent stock delivery reaches you on time.
‘‘Nominating someone for their outstanding service or products is a great way to thank these people, who are the backbone of our community.’’
Mr Loe said businesses could also self-nominate to show staff how much their efforts were valued.

The St George Business Awards are made possible by the ongoing support of major sponsors, Georges River Council and NOVA Employment and support sponsors, Ramsgate RSL.
Nominations for the 2019 St George Local Business Awards will close on Tuesday, March 12 with the winners announced at the awards presentation evening, on Wednesday, May 8.
